A “dram” that adds color to everyday life
The word “dram” began to refer to whisky around the 18th century in Scotland. Its roots trace back to the ancient Greek word drachme. As the term traveled through Britain and arrived in Scotland, it came to mean “a small amount of whisky”—a comforting measure often shared among friends and family on a cold night. Even today, “dram” remains a beloved word that brings a touch of everyday happiness to those who enjoy it.

- Color
- Golden with a hint of orange
- Flavor
- Vanilla, fresh flowers, a meadow of new greenery, and pleasant oak aromas
- Taste
- Soft malt sweetness, floral nectar, brown sugar, and baked pastries
- Finish
- Refreshing acidity, woody notes, and a touch of spice
- Alc
- 46
- Volume
- 700ml
